Careers in STEM focus of Tuesday program at H-F

Area students and parents are invited to Homewood-Flossmoor High School’s 6th Annual Careers in STEM Night from 6:30 to 9 p.m. on Tuesday, Feb. 7, at the high school. Prairie State cancels many classes because of power outage

Prairie State College in Chicago Heights has canceled classes this week because of a power outage affecting portions of the campus.
